さなか
noun
in the midst of; in the middle of; at the height of
writtentime-general
1. in the midst of, in the middle of, at the height of
Refers to the very middle of an ongoing action, event, or season. Often emphasizes that something is at its peak or most intense point.
The phone rang in the middle of the meeting.
A power outage happened at the height of summer.
A friend contacted me with an invitation while I was in the middle of studying for exams, so I couldn't concentrate.

Reading note: The same kanji 最中(さいちゅう) (read さいちゅう) is more commonly used in everyday speech, especially in the pattern 〜している最中(さいちゅう). The reading さなか is more literary.

Similar words

  • 最中(さなか): literary, emphasizes being at the peak or critical point
  • 最中(さいちゅう): neutral, common in everyday speech
  • 途中(とちゅう): in the middle of (a process, journey)
